Mazza Recycling Acquires Bull Waste & Recycling in New Jersey

Caroline Raffetto

Mazza Recycling Services, a leading recycler and hauler of metals and construction materials based in Tinton Falls, New Jersey, has expanded its footprint by acquiring Bull Waste & Recycling, a hauling company located in Berlin, New Jersey. This strategic acquisition marks Mazza's third expansion of the year and is set to enhance its service offerings in the region, strengthening its position as a leader in South Jersey's waste management industry.

The acquisition will allow Mazza to integrate Bull Waste's operations into its own, offering an expanded array of waste and recycling services across Monmouth, Ocean, and Middlesex counties, as well as a broader reach into the Camden and Burlington counties, where Mazza has already established a solid presence. Jimmy Mazza Jr., President and CEO of Mazza Recycling, emphasized the importance of this move, stating, “Since acquiring Liberty Waste and Recycling earlier this year, we’ve been able to provide exceptional waste and recycling collection services throughout Camden and Burlington counties. The services provided by Bull Waste and Recycling align perfectly with our existing business lines in Monmouth, Ocean, and Middlesex counties. This acquisition helps us move closer to our overall vision of becoming the number one hauling company in South Jersey and the greater Philadelphia area."

Founded in 1991 by Dave Smith, Mount Group initially focused on construction services and later diversified into utility services, concrete, paving, and recycling. Its recycling branch, Bull Waste & Recycling, provided roll-off container services in several New Jersey counties, including Burlington, Mercer, Gloucester, and Camden. Smith explained that the decision to sell Bull Waste to Mazza was influenced by their shared values and commitment to integrity, saying, "The decision to move forward with the Mazza team in the sale of Bull Waste was largely driven by their character and integrity. We are confident that the Mazza team will embrace the employees and customers of Bull Waste in a way consistent with our beliefs and practices."

Mazza Recycling noted that the acquisition of Bull Waste & Recycling’s containers—ranging from 10-yard to 40-yard sizes—will complement its existing industrial, commercial, and construction waste and recycling hauling operations. This will also help Mazza streamline operations and improve efficiencies in their service delivery to customers.
